The Uncollected Poetry and Prose of Walt Whitman Volume 2 is a collection of various early manuscripts of the renowned American poet, Walt Whitman. The book includes a wide range of unpublished poems, essays, and other writings that were not included in his previous works. The manuscripts were discovered and compiled by the editor, Emory Holloway, who provides an introduction to the book. The collection offers a unique insight into the creative process of one of America's most celebrated poets and sheds light on the evolution of his writing style. The book is a must-read for fans of Whitman's work, as well as anyone interested in the history of American literature.This Is A New Release Of The Original 1921 Edition.This scarce antiquarian book is a facsimile reprint of the old original and may contain some imperfections such as library marks and notations.
